Summary:
|
Quantum key distribution network (QKDN) is a cryptographic infrastructure to provide secure symmetric keys to cryptographic applications in user networks. Constructing a large scale QKDN which covers wide area, it may consist of multiple QKDNs and they are interworking each other.
The functional requirements and architecture of single QKDN are specified based on the functional requirements of QKDN in [ITU-T Y.3801], functional architecture and operational procedures of QKDN in [ITU-T Y.3802]. This recommendation is to specify a framework for interworking QKDNs. Security considerations are mentioned when it is directly related to the security of keys.
This Recommendation will consider the following aspects for interworking QKDNs.
1) Interworking between QKDNs supported by different QKDN providers.
NOTE - QKDN provider is specified in [draft ITU-T Y.QKDN_BM].
2) Interworking between QKDNs with different technologies.
Different technologies can be used in QKDNs such as:
- Key relay encryption methods (i.e. OTP, AES etc.)
- Key relay schemes (i.e. case 1 and case 2 which are specified in [ITU-T Y.3800])
- Key relay alternatives (i.e. XORs uniformly processed at destination node etc. which are specified in [ITU-T Y.3803])
- Configurations of QKDN controller (i.e. centralized QKDN or distributed QKDN which are specified in [ITU-T Y.3802]
- Protocols in the key management layer, the QKDN control layer and the QKDN management layer.
NOTE - Details of protocols is outside the scope of this Recommendation.
